On Saturday, Merlin Entertainments opened the nation’s second Peppa Pig Theme Park within the Dallas-Fort Price space, following the success of the first location in Winter Haven, Florida.
The brand new Peppa Pig Theme Park is in North Richland Hills, a northeastern suburb of Fort Price. It is subsequent door to the 17-acre NRH2O Household Water Park and fewer than half-hour from the Legoland Discovery Middle and the Sea Life Grapevine aquarium.

Tickets to Peppa Pig Theme Park begin at $27.99 per individual and embrace one free digital picture obtain and one free digital video obtain. There are additionally packages that embrace Peppa Pig ears and different collectible objects, and annual passes can be found for $99 per individual. Youngsters beneath 2 years of age don’t require a ticket to go to the park.
As a result of the park is close to different Melin-owned points of interest, combo tickets that embrace admission to Peppa Pig World of Play Dallas, Legoland Discovery Middle and the Sea Life Grapevine aquarium are additionally accessible.
Peppa Pig Theme Park’s Texas location has 5 rides, a water play space and a great deal of actions designed only for youngsters. Daddy Pig’s Curler Coaster is an ideal first curler coaster for little ones however might even make mother and father let loose a squeal or two. The opposite rides embrace Peppa Pig’s Balloon Trip, Grandad Canine’s Pirate Boat Trip, Grampy Rabbit’s Dinosaur Journey and Mr. Bull’s Excessive Striker.
In between rides, youngsters can go to play areas throughout the park, such because the Muddy Puddles Splash Pad (convey a swimsuit and a towel to dry off after), a bicycle and tricycle path, a playground, and a Enjoyable Honest with free carnival video games and character meet-and-greets. Eating is offered at Miss Rabbit’s Diner, with kid-friendly menu objects like pizza, sandwiches and “muddy puddle milkshakes.”

Like different Merlin-owned points of interest, the brand new Peppa Pig Theme Park emphasizes accessibility. Many rides and factors of curiosity have been designed with wheelchair customers in thoughts; the park additionally has accreditation by way of the Worldwide Board of Credentialing and Persevering with Schooling Requirements as a Licensed Autism Middle, that means employees members have sensory consciousness coaching, and every attraction has a sensory information for folks.
What units Peppa Pig Theme Park other than different parks is that it’s particularly geared towards youthful youngsters. Youngsters will not should be caught within the stroller shuffling from experience to experience all day lengthy. Peppa Pig Theme Park is sufficiently small and laid out so that youngsters can run round and discover (whereas their mother and father try and sustain with them).
Its smaller dimension additionally means you may expertise your complete park in in the future, making Peppa Pig Theme Park the newest in a development towards smaller and extra reasonably priced “micro parks,” such because the Common Children Resort theme park additionally beneath growth in Texas.
